TURN-208: Gatevale turnstile counters at the Merrow Field pilot double-count when a rotation reverses mid-cycle. Attendance totals drift roughly 2% high per event. The debounce window fix is implemented, reviewed by Ilsa, and soak-tested across two simulated match days without drift. Ready for your cut; the candidate build is identified below.

trace token, tagag-tafog: htk6_5ed18c

Careful read on the debounce logic here. The Hallowgate turnstile counter must never double-count a single rotation, but it also can't drop entries during rush ingress — that's a safety occupancy number, not just analytics. Your edge-detection window looks right, but the anti-replay threshold interacts with the sensor poll rate in a way that should be documented, since an attacker jamming the optical sensor could exploit a gap. Please confirm these constants were validated against the Merrowfield load test before merge.

limits module of taguf-bafog:
WEIGHTS = {
    "oliok": 618,
    "istiel": 638,
    "holok": 468,
    "norael": 653,
    "eliys": 63,
    "eliax": 785,
    "fraeth": 507,
}

### Account Recovery — Catalogue Import (Lintwood)

Quick one for review: when the Lintwood catalogue import wipes a patron's session table, the recovery flow re-seeds accounts from the nightly snapshot. Check that the importer skips locked accounts — last time it didn't. To rerun recovery against staging you'll need the vault passphrase, which is appended just below.

recovery phrase for yafof-tajof: julmir-kelax-julvan-holath-belvan-holir-ralael-ralvan-ralath-julvan-silmir-istmir-kaswyn-ulamir